A Closer Look at the Itinerary

Starting at Vilamoura Marina: The journey begins at Cais I, facing the Tivoli Marina Hotel, with check-in recommended at least 30 minutes before departure. The vessel, a replica of a traditional American schooner, sets the tone with its charming design and spacious deck, perfect for absorbing the coastal views.
Sailing Along the Algarve Coast: Over approximately five hours, you’ll cruise past some of Portugal’s most scenic spots. Expect to see towering cliffs, golden beaches, and small fishing villages, all set against a backdrop of clear blue waters. The guides—fluent in English and Portuguese—share insights about the coastline’s geological formations and local history, enriching your appreciation of the scenery.
Benagil Cave Visit: The highlight for many is the visit to the famous Benagil Cave, a natural wonder with a towering skylight and stunning interior. Reviewers note that the 10-minute stop allows for photos and a brief look inside, though disembarking isn’t permitted. Clear weather and safe sea conditions are required for this visit, so plans could shift if the sea is rough. One guest appreciated the guided commentary during the cruise, which helped them understand the cave’s significance.
Secluded Beach & BBQ: After the cave exploration, the boat anchors at a hidden gem—a beach only accessible by boat. Here, you’ll have about 1.5 hours to swim, sunbathe, and enjoy the delicious beachside BBQ. The meal is grilled on-site and served with bottled water and alcoholic beverages, making it an ideal occasion to unwind and soak up the sun. Reviewers like Tahira from Belgium highlighted how “the BBQs on the beach were awesome,” emphasizing the relaxed, authentic vibe of this stop.
Return to Vilamoura: After the beach break, the vessel heads back, with the option to catch more scenic views or enjoy a drink as you unwind. The total duration averages around 7 hours, making it a full but manageable day trip.

More Great Thing To Do NearbyPractical Tips for Travelers
- Arrive early: Check-in opens 30 minutes before departure; arriving late could mean missing the boat.
- Bring essentials: Sunglasses, swimwear, towels, sunscreen, and a waterproof camera are must-haves.
- Dress appropriately: Light, comfortable clothing for the boat and beach shoes if you want to explore the sand.
- Weather considerations: Since cave visits depend on sea conditions, flexible plans are advisable. The tour cannot guarantee cave access in rough weather.
- Safety: Disembarking in caves isn’t permitted, and signing a liability waiver is required for beach disembarkation.
- Group size: The boat is a traditional schooner, so expect a cozy, friendly atmosphere with other travelers.

FAQ
Is hotel pickup included?
No, the tour starts at Vilamoura Marina, and guests need to make their way there.
How long is the cruise?
The entire experience lasts approximately 7 hours, including travel, sightseeing, beach stop, and return.
What should I bring?
Sunglasses, swimwear, towels, sunscreen, and a camera are recommended.
Are drinks included?
Yes, bottled water and alcoholic beverages are provided.
Can I disembark in the caves?
No, for safety reasons disembarking inside the caves isn’t allowed.
Is the tour suitable for children?
The provided info doesn’t specify age restrictions, but the experience is generally suited for older children who can enjoy boat trips and beach activities.
What happens if sea conditions are bad?
Cave visits and exploring rock formations depend on sea conditions. The tour may be adjusted or delayed for safety.
Is there any dolphin watching?
Some reviews mention dolphin sightings, but they’re not guaranteed.
Do I need to book in advance?
Yes, booking ahead is recommended, and full refunds are available if canceled 24 hours in advance.
